🍊 4 Fun Facts About Dekopon (デコポン)

  1. 🎩 It Has a Signature “Top Knot”
    One of the easiest ways to recognize a Dekopon is its unique bumpy top, often called a "top knot." It’s not just cute—it’s iconic!

  2. 🍬 Naturally Super Sweet
    Dekopon oranges are famously sweet and low in acidity, with no sugar added. In fact, they’re considered one of the sweetest citrus fruits in the world!

  3. 🔍 Technically a Brand, Not a Fruit Name
    “Dekopon” is actually a brand name for a variety of citrus called Shiranui. Only fruits that meet strict sweetness and size standards can be labeled as Dekopon in Japan.

  4. 🚫 No Seeds, No Problem
    Dekopons are 100% seedless, making them a favorite snack for kids and adults alike. Just peel and enjoy—no mess, no fuss!
